Molex connector is defined as the vernacular term for the two-piece pin and socket interconnection, most frequently disk drive connectors. Pioneered by the Molex Connector Company, the two-piece design that became an early electronic standard. Molex designed and patented first examples of this connector style in the late 1950s and during early 1960s. It was first utilized in home appliances, and then the industries soon began developing it within their products from the automobiles to the vending machines then to the mini-computers.

Molex refers to a four pin power connector found within the SMPS. It is used in order to supply power to the CD Drive, HDD, DVD Drive and so on.
